AI for Product Teams
Over the last 30 years or so, the number of coders has grown dramatically to accommodate professional needs. Starting below a million in the US in the early 90’s, it is estimated there are well over 30 million professional software engineers as we head into 2025. That count does not include the millions and millions of web development tool users managing their own needs, with little formal coding training, relying on tools such as WordPress, HubSpot, Spotify, GoDaddy, and AWS to generate the templated code that is needed.
The Rise of AI Coding Tools
For anyone who has used AI coding tools like CoPilot from GitHub, it is easy to see that AI tools thrive at generating code. They are largely semantic language engines after all. Given most coding languages are meant to be semantically unambiguous for a computer to execute the code properly, the sophistication AI embodies to understand and generate ambiguous spoken languages like English is largely left unneeded. Code-generating tools still suffer from garbage-in/garbage-out risks (as do AI chat tools like ChatGPT). This is where AI-augmented skills for human operators (you and me) become critical, to get the value you want to realize and possibly to preserve the jobs.
The Role of Product Managers
For Product managers, the essence of the Product role is the synthesis of streams of requirements (input) to create the output an Engineering team can use to economically build, and a business can take to market to generate revenue. The more unambiguous and consistent the output a Product team can produce, the more likely coders and sales teams will be able to meet the needs identified.

AI’s Impact on Job Roles
Coders and Product managers are two of the areas most ripe to be transformed through comprehensive adoption of AI. Jobs will change, and it's important to explore how to migrate your talents to where AI drives them. Here are some potential shifts to consider:
- Enhanced Skill Sets: As AI takes over more routine coding tasks, coders will need to develop skills in AI management and integration.
- Strategic Roles: Product managers may evolve into more strategic roles, focusing on high-level decision-making rather than day-to-day operational tasks.
- Cross-functional Teams: The future may see more cross-functional teams that blend technical skills with business acumen, enabling holistic product development.
Challenges in AI Implementation
Despite the numerous advantages that AI brings to product teams, the implementation of AI technologies is not without its challenges:
- Data Quality: AI systems are only as good as the data fed into them. Ensuring high-quality, relevant data is crucial for effective AI performance.
- Change Management: Transitioning to AI-augmented workflows requires careful change management to ensure that team members are on board and adequately trained.
- Ethical Considerations: The use of AI raises various ethical considerations, including bias in algorithms and the impact on employment. These issues must be addressed proactively.
